Transgenic hirudin is obtained from

Options

(a) Ocimum sanctum
(b) Brassica napus
(c) Potato
(d) Tomato

Correct Answer:

Brassica napus

Explanation:

Hirudin, a blood anticoagulant protein from leeches, and β-glucuronidase were produced in Brassica carinata Braun (Ethiopian mustard) seeds using oleosin as a carrier.
